Comprehending Hyundai Car Keys
Hyundai Amica Replacement Key car keys been available in different kinds depending on the model and year of the lorry. The key types normally fall into the following categories:
Key TypeDescriptionCommon Models/YearsTraditional KeyFundamental mechanical key with no electronic functionsOlder modelsTransponder KeyFeatures a chip that communicates with the car's immobilizer systemModels from 2000s onwardsSmart KeyKeyless entry and push-to-start systemMore recent designs such as the Sonata, Genesis, and TucsonKey FobRemote control for locking/unlocking doors, often integrated with transponder innovationNumerous models from 2010 onwardsWhy Replacement is Necessary
There are several situations that might require a replacement Hyundai car key:

Lost Keys: Misplacing the car key prevails and normally the most uncomplicated factor for requiring a replacement.

Broken Keys: Keys can become damaged through wear and tear or accidental breakage, especially if they are made of plastic.

Stolen Keys: In cases of theft, getting a Replacement Hyundai Keys key is necessary for the safety of the automobile.

Key Malfunction: Electronic keys or fobs may lose their charge or end up being unprogrammed, requiring a replacement or reprogramming.
Actions to Replace Your Hyundai Car Key
The process to replace a Hyundai car key can vary based on the key type. Below is a basic guide to facilitate this procedure.
1. Determine Your Key Type
Figure out whether you have a traditional key, transponder key, smart key, or key fob. The procedure for replacement will vary based upon your key type.
2. Gather Required Documents
Before heading to get a replacement key, ensure you have the following documents all set:
DocumentFunctionCar TitleProves ownership of the automobileChauffeur's LicenseValidates your identityVIN (Vehicle Identification Number)Necessary for key programs3. Choose Your Replacement Method
There are typically three main options for acquiring a replacement key:
MethodDescriptionProsConsDealershipAuthorized Hyundai dealers can offer replacement keys, typically with expert programming services.Surefire compatibility, expert serviceTypically more costly, might require long wait times.Locksmith professionalA licensed vehicle locksmith can develop replacement keys for most Hyundai vehicles.Usually more affordable, quicker service possibleQuality might vary, absence of guarantee on some keys.Do it yourself OnlineYou can buy a blank key online to be programmed at a regional locksmith professional or DIY with the correct tools.Economical, convenience of shopping from homeRequires technical skills, risk of typos or wrong key types.4. Programming the Key
Most modern-day Hyundai keys require programs to sync with your car. Keys acquired online might not be pre-programmed, necessitating a check out to a dealer or locksmith for this service.
5. Testing the New Key
After shows, test the key to ensure it works correctly. Examine for:
Locking/Unlocking: Ensure the remote functions are responsive.Starting the Vehicle: Confirm the car starts without concern.Check Alarm: If geared up, make sure any alarm systems set off effectively.Cost of Replacement Hyundai Car Keys
To provide a clearer understanding of expenses included, we've compiled a table based upon key type and approach of replacement:

Can I drive my Hyundai without a key?
No, driving a Hyundai without the appropriate key is not possible due to the immobilizer system in many newer models that prevents the engine from beginning.
2. The length of time does it require to get a replacement key?
It can differ depending on the approach. A dealership may take a number of hours to a day, while a locksmith professional can typically offer a replacement within an hour.
3. Will my car insurance coverage cover key replacement?
Lots of insurance plan cover key Replacement Key For Hyundai I20 as part of comprehensive coverage, but it is a good idea to inspect with your service provider for specifics.
4. Do I need to program the key myself if I buy it online?
More than likely, yes. You'll require to take it to a locksmith or car dealership to have it configured to your automobile.
